core: dt: Make it possible to alter device mapping

In case where IP core device is TrustZone aware and is used by both REE
and TEE dt_map_dev() would normally cause non-secure mapping for the
device.

When selected registers in IP core are only accessible by TrustZone device
needs to be mapped with MEM_AREA_IO_SEC to cause actual AXI memory access
be made with AWPROT[1] and ARPROT[1] bits configured properly.

This adds new argument for dt_map_dev() to enable forcing mapping to be
secure or non-secure.

drivers: atmel_trng: Switch to hw_get_random_bytes()

hw_get_random_byte() is no longer used. The default crypto_rng_read()
calls hw_get_random_bytes() now so we do not need to override this
and can simply implement just hw_get_random_bytes().

drivers: clk: change clk_dt_get_by_*() prototype

Changes clk_dt_get_by_idx() and clk_dt_get_by_name() to return a
the TEE_Result code and use an output argument to pass back
clock reference rather than the opposite. This change makes
clk_dt_get_by_*() function more consistent with the other
OP-TEE core API functions.

Also renames clk_dt_get_by_idx() to clk_dt_get_by_index().

Updates sama5d2_clk.c and atmel_trng.c accordingly.
